What Causes Window Condensation?
Condensation is primarily an outcome of the laws of physics associated to temperature and humidity. Here are the primary causes:
1. Temperature Differences
When warm, damp air in your house satisfies a colder window surface, the air cools and loses its capability to hold moisture. This leads to water beads forming on the glass.
2. High Indoor Humidity
Activities such as cooking, showering, and even breathing add to the humidity inside a home. When this damp air comes into contact with chillier windows, condensation takes place.
3. Poor Ventilation
Poor air flow can trap moisture inside, leading to higher humidity levels that favor condensation on windows.
4. Inadequate Insulation
Single-pane windows or older double-pane windows lacking appropriate insulation can easily become cold enough for condensation to form.
5. Weather condition Changes
Abrupt changes in weather, particularly during the winter season months, can likewise cause increased condensation as the air outside cools quickly.
The Science Behind Condensation
To much better understand condensation, let's take a look at a short science summary. The capability of air to hold moisture increases with temperature level. Warm air holds more moisture than cold air. When air cools off to its dew point, the water vapor condenses into liquid type-- in this case, on your windows.

Implications of Window Condensation
While condensation itself might not seem damaging, it can lead to several issues if left unaddressed:

- Mold Growth: Persistent moisture can develop an ideal environment for mold and mildew, posing health threats to residents.
- Frame Damage: Wooden window frames can warp, crack, or rot due to constant exposure to moisture.
- Glass Damage: Condensation typically results in clouding between window panes, decreasing transparency and visual value.

1. Improve Ventilation
- Usage Exhaust Fans: In kitchen areas and restrooms, utilizing exhaust fans can assist remove excess moisture.
- Open Windows: When weather condition allows, open windows to enable fresh air to flow.
2. Control Indoor Humidity
- Use Dehumidifiers: These gadgets can efficiently reduce humidity levels within the home.
- Houseplants: While they can be advantageous, a lot of plants can increase humidity levels. Balance is essential.
3. Insulate Windows

- Use Thermal Curtains: Heavy drapes or thermal window coverings can assist keep warmer window surfaces.
4. Change Heating
- Set Thermostat: Maintain a consistent heating level throughout the home to avoid cold areas where condensation might form.
5. Regular Maintenance

- Tidy Condensation: Regularly clean moisture off windows to avoid mold and mildew development.
Quick Tips for Reducing Condensation:
- Maintain a consistent indoor temperature.
- Use moisture absorbers in high-humidity areas.
- Routinely monitor humidity levels with a hygrometer.
Often Asked Questions (FAQs)
1. Is condensation on windows normal?
Yes, particularly during the colder months. It is a natural result of temperature level differences and humidity levels.
2. When is condensation a problem?

3. How can I avoid condensation?
Improving ventilation, reducing humidity, and insulating windows are efficient techniques to prevent condensation.
4. Are there particular windows less vulnerable to condensation?

5. Should I be concerned about mold due to condensation?
Yes, if you see persistent condensation, it is essential to examine for mold growth and act to alleviate both the moisture and the health threats associated.
